Heidi Klum: The Queen Returns

Courtesy of Max Montgomery
For more than two decades, Heidi Klum has turned Halloween into her personal art form. Her annual party in New York has become a fashion phenomenon a place where A-list guests don’t just “dress up,” they transform. This year, Klum took her creativity to a mythical new level, appearing as Medusa, the legendary of Greek mythology.
The look was jaw-dropping: a shimmering green-scaled bodysuit, an enormous snake tail that slithered with every step, and a crown of mechanical serpents that actually moved on their own. It wasn’t just a costume, it was a performance. Klum spent more than nine hours in the makeup chair to bring Medusa to life, supported by her longtime special effects partner Mike Marino and a team of 15 artists who worked for months to perfect every detail.
Medusa’s Many Faces

Courtesy of Max Montgomery
Medusa, as a figure, carries a fascinating duality that makes her a recurring muse in art, literature, and fashion. For centuries she has been depicted as a monster her snake-covered head and petrifying gaze representing fear and danger. But more recent interpretations have reclaimed her story as something deeper: a symbol of transformation, resilience, and female strength.
In mythology, Medusa wasn’t born a villain she was a mortal woman punished and transformed by the gods.
Seen through that lens, it’s no surprise that Medusa continues to enchant the creative world, her story fits perfectly within the spirit of Halloween, a night where we blur boundaries between the real and the imagined, the frightening and the fabulous.
